Educational Field Trips
Field trips at the Michelson Museum are filled with fun and learning for all ages. Every students leaves with a masterpiece and new creative knowledge. Using exhibitions, artists of all kinds, and art education techniques, the Michelson provides something valuable to every participant.
Field trips may be planned for schools, homeschool groups, organizations, and clubs. For any questions, contact us!

PROGRAMS
The Michelson Museum creates partnerships with colleges and school districts throughout East Texas and works to enrich their curricula in broad academic areas.
Programs and tours are interactive or hands-on, as requested. The museum sponsors student exhibits and receptions throughout the year.
The rich cultural mix of students and their families in East Texas is an integral part of the program.
DR. DAVID WEISMAN HIRSCH DISCOVERY ROOM
For 30 years, families have enjoyed this bright, colorful space at the Michelson’s entrance. Adults must remain with their visiting children. Spontaneity of expression develops as children apply their own designs to the carpeted walls; selected safe manipulatives, books, and toys appeal to all ages. Surrounded by art in the Discovery Room, learning is fun. As with all of the Michelson's programs, no fee is charged for the use of the Discovery Room.
